What is a survey party chief?

Survey Party Chiefs are professionals who lead field survey crews in measuring and mapping land, construction sites, or other areas for engineering, construction, or land development projects. They are responsible for planning survey activities, managing crew members, and ensuring accurate data collection using specialized equipment such as GPS, total stations, and levels. Survey Party Chiefs interpret project plans and specifications, maintain field records, and coordinate with project managers and engineers to ensure survey work meets required standards.

What does a survey party chief do?

As a survey party chief, your job is to oversee land surveys. In this role, you may plan out each study, check the characteristics of the ground and surrounding land, evaluate its potential as a construction site, and manage personnel on a survey team. A survey party chief may lead up to seven other people at a time, ensure measurements are accurate, research information, prepare maps, and present findings to relevant groups or individuals. This is primarily a management role, but many people in this position have experience in other positions and can cover other duties as needed.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a survey party chief,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Survey Party Chief, you need expertise in land surveying techniques, boundary determination, and a solid understanding of mathematics, typically supported by relevant education or certification. Proficiency with surveying instruments (like total stations and GPS), data collection software, and CAD systems is crucial.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ills are essential for managing field crews and collaborating with clients or engineers. These skills and qualities ensure accurate measurements, efficient workflow, and successful project outcomes in the field.

What are some common challenges faced by a survey party chief in the field, and how can they be addressed?

Survey Party Chiefs often encounter challenges such as working in difficult terrain, managing precise measurements under changing weather conditions, and coordinating a team with varying levels of experience. Effective communication, proper planning, and the use of modern surveying equipment can help address these issues. Additionally, adapting quickly to unexpected site conditions and ensuring safety protocols are followed are essential for maintaining project accuracy and team well-being.

What is the difference between Survey Party Chief vs Survey Technician?

AspectSurvey Party ChiefSurvey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ma, relevant certifications, experience in surveyingHigh school diploma, technical training or certifications in surveying
Work EnvironmentLeads survey crews in field settings, outdoor environmentsSupports fieldwork, operates surveying equipment, often in the field or office
ResponsibilitiesOversees survey operations, manages team, ensures accuracyPerforms measurements, operates equipment, assists in data collection

The Survey Party Chief typically manages survey crews and oversees field operations, requiring leadership skills and experience. The Survey Technician supports data collection and equipment operation, often with technical training. Both roles work closely in surveying projects, but the Party Chief has more supervisory responsibilities.

Job description

Overview

Kimley-Horn is seeking a Survey Field Representative to join the Orange office! This is not a remote position.

Responsibilities
  • Perform medium-scale field surveys for ALTA, engineering design topo and boundary purposes acting in the capacity of the party chief
  • Prepare field notes and sketches, pre-calc and download field data and process conventional and GPS data using Star*Net software.
  • Research boundary and easement title documents and perform boundary analysis.
  • Use AutoCAD Civil 3D software to produce detailed subdivision maps, ALTA survey, topographic surveys and other various survey related maps or exhibits.
  • Prepare legal descriptions and exhibits for right of way, easements, acquisition parcels, etc.
Qualifications
  • Land Surveyor in Training (LSIT) Certification and/or Professional Land Surveyor (PLS) Certification desired
  • 10+ year of experience as a Chief of Parties or Party Chief
  • Bachelors in a surveying or engineering curriculum
  • Experience utilizing GPS RTK and static data collection
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
